HOW TREZOR HARDWARE LOGIN® FUNCTIONS
Trezor Hardware Login® works through encrypted communication between the hardware wallet and supported platforms. When a login request is initiated, the connected platform sends a secure verification prompt to the Trezor® device.
The user must then review and approve the request directly on the hardware wallet screen. This process ensures that login approval remains under the owner’s physical control. Since sensitive authentication credentials never leave the device, the risk of online interception is significantly reduced.
Unlike traditional authentication systems, which often depend on centralized password storage, hardware-based login minimizes exposure to hacking attempts. Every authentication request requires active confirmation from the device holder, making unauthorized remote access much more difficult.

SETTING UP TREZOR HARDWARE LOGIN®
To begin using Trezor Hardware Login®, users first need to initialize their Trezor® hardware wallet and install the latest firmware updates. Updated firmware improves security, device stability, and compatibility with supported applications.
After setup is complete, users can connect their device to supported login platforms through compatible software environments such as Trezor Suite. The platform will request authorization to communicate with the hardware wallet during the first connection.
Once paired successfully, users can securely verify login requests directly from the device whenever authentication is required. This streamlined process creates a safer login experience without sacrificing convenience.
For added protection, users are strongly encouraged to activate a PIN code and optional passphrase. These features help protect wallet access if the physical device is lost or stolen.

BEST PRACTICES FOR SAFE HARDWARE AUTHENTICATION
Although Trezor Hardware Login® offers strong protection, users should still follow good cybersecurity habits. Devices should always be purchased from trusted sources to avoid tampered hardware.
Users should also verify website addresses carefully before approving login requests. Fake websites designed to imitate trusted crypto platforms remain a common phishing threat.
The wallet recovery phrase should always remain private and stored offline in a secure location. Sharing recovery information with anyone could compromise wallet security completely.
Regular firmware updates are equally important because they include new security patches and software improvements that strengthen overall device performance.
